People in the North West waiting up to 12 weeks before sitting driving test



People in the North West have to wait on average almost 12 weeks before they can sit their driving test according to the latest RSA figures.

Only Sligo is below the National average of 10 weeks with a waiting time of 9.3 weeks.

Donegal Town test centre however shows an average wait time of 15.6 with one person having to wait 21 weeks.

While Carrick on Shannon test centre has an average of an 11 week wait and the longest someone was delayed is 22 weeks.

The worst affected centre in the country is Buncranna Test Centre with the average wait time being 19 weeks.
